Appert, Nicolas

    Name:
    Appert, Nicolas
    Detailed information:
    (1752–1841). A French pioneer in the science of food preservation. Though not a chemist, his work on application of heat to food products led to a form of home preserving that eventually developed into the canning industry. The idea of destroying bacteria by heat treatment was later applied more exhaustively by Pasteur.
